Conservatives Prioritize Access to High-speed Internet

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E
April 30, 2021

Barrhead AB: Peace River – Westlock Member of Parliament Arnold Viersen, issued the following statement regarding the importance of access to high-speed Internet in a post-COVID-19 world and the commitment from Canada’s Conservatives to increase access in rural communities:

“As COVID-19 has made increasingly clear, having access to fast and reliable Internet is not a luxury we can afford to be without – it’s a necessity. This is especially true here in Peace River – Westlock. Currently, according to the CRTC, only 45.6 percent of rural communities in Canada have access to broadband Internet. In Alberta, it’s less than 9% of rural communities with access to speeds of 50 Mbps download and 10 Mbps upload. Given how crucial online access has become in a post-COVID-19 world, that is truly an alarming statistic for our community.

“Many constituents across our riding are frustrated with the lack of progress on increasing access to reliable Internet. The Liberals make billion-dollar rural Internet announcements, but very little actually gets done. This is because the Liberals require the private sector to jump through hoops and experience delays of up to five years to get projects approved. We need a federal government that simplifies and streamlines the process so the private sector can invest and expand broadband.

“Constituents of Peace River – Westlock can have confidence that Canada’s Conservatives will present a plan to accelerate reliable Internet access and increase network capacity so that no one is deprived of these essential services.
